Mainsaver Selected For State-Of-The-Art Waste Treatment Plants

http://www.hazeng.co.uk/images/stories/Spidex%20PR%20.jpgSpidex Software has announced that Global Renewables, an innovative resource recovery specialist, has selected Spidex’s Mainsaver CMMS solution to manage engineering maintenance at its two newly-built state-of -the-art waste treatment facilities in Lancashire.

The new waste processing sites are the centrepiece of a 25-year, ฃ2bn PFI project which has the capacity to process up to 600,000 tonnes of household waste per year, reclaiming the maximum amount of recyclables and converting the remaining organic fraction into renewable energy and compost.

The new Global Renewables waste processing facilities will deploy some of the most advanced and environmentally-responsible technologies available. Central to these is the UR-3R Processฎ, a combined mechanical/biological separation treatment specifically designed for municipal solid waste, which has Greenpeace among its advocates.

The process dramatically decreases the amount of waste consigned to landfill and consequent greenhouse gas emissions.
